Feedback Components
Visual feedback components that keep users informed about system status, operations, and important information. All components are ARIA-compliant and mobile-optimized.
Alert Messages
Contextual alerts for important information, warnings, and system messages.
Order Confirmed!
Limited Stock
Payment Failed
Market Hours Update
Inline Feedback
Accessible feedback that appears near the action that triggered it. Messages stay visible until dismissed, ensuring users have time to read and understand the feedback.
Why Inline Feedback?
- WCAG 2.2.1 Timing Adjustable: Error messages never auto-dismiss, giving users time to read
- WCAG 1.3.2 Meaningful Sequence: Feedback appears near the action that triggered it
- Screen Reader Friendly: Uses aria-live regions for announcements
- User Control: Dismissible when users are ready, not on a timer
Loading States
Various loading indicators for different contexts and use cases.
Button Loading
Spinner
Skeleton Loader
Progress Bar
75% Complete
Empty States
Friendly messages when there's no content to display.
Your cart is empty
Start shopping to add items to your cart
No orders yet
When you place your first order, it will appear here
No results found
Try adjusting your search or filters
Form Validation
Inline validation messages for form inputs.
Tooltips
Contextual help text that appears on hover or focus.
Status Badges
Small indicators for status, labels, and counts.